Output 3f38b03331cbb4dd4e8a2c768f23f5ebd4c99c675b2d245be241e28185aaafd4:8

value
719798626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 660b7004a1ede6bf8557d591f1cfc693fcf411f6 OP_EQUAL
address
3AzaYokKzwUdvhYcR1xqwSTBLjE2bGxReE
transaction
3f38b03331cbb4dd4e8a2c768f23f5ebd4c99c675b2d245be241e28185aaafd4
spent
true